工業相機系統的制作方法
【專利說明】工業相機系統 【技術領域】
[0001] 本實用新型涉及一種工業相機系統,尤其是指一種可調節圖像輸出分辨率的工業 相機系統。 【【背景技術】】
[0002] 如中國大陸專利CN201110390478. 6提供了一種運動目標特征高速視覺捕捉裝 置,其包括FPGA,分別與FPGA連接的數字相機接口模塊、原始圖像VGA接口模塊、處理圖像 VGA接口模塊、ARM微處理器以及DSP處理器。
[0003] 當數字相機采集原始圖像,然后將采集到的圖像信號傳送至FPGA進行處理,FPGA 設有雙處理圖像VGA接口模塊,可實現對數字相機發送的原始圖像和經過FPGA算法之后的 處理結果圖像進行實時的雙屏顯示,ARM微處理器是對FPGA及DSP運行程序的開始與終止 控制,DSP接收FPGA傳送的圖像信號作進一步運算且與ARM微處理器進行數據通信,然而 用戶可以自由選用顯示設備與FPGA做連接用以顯示處理結果圖像,但是各種顯示設備有 自己的分辨率,當兩者分辨率不匹配時,處理結果圖像與采集原始圖像會不相同,也就是所 謂的失真。
[0004] 如果FPGA只能連接一種與其分辨率相匹配的顯示設備,即不能與其他分辨率不 匹配的顯示設備連接,從而導致與其連接的顯示設備單一,用戶選擇范圍較窄,不利于選擇 靈活性需求和充分利用現有的設備資源。
[0005] 因此,有必要設計一種新的工業相機系統,以克服上述問題。 【【實用新型內容】】
[0006] 本實用新型的創作目的在于提供一種可調節圖像輸出分辨率的工業相機系統。
[0007] 為了達到上述目的,本實用新型采用如下技術方案:
[0008] -種工業相機系統,包括:一工業相機,其具有一現場可編程門陣列FPGA模塊, 所述現場可編程門陣列FPGA模塊設有一第一圖像顯示接口模塊和一第二圖像顯示接口模 塊;一圖像傳感器,連接所述現場可編程門陣列FPGA模塊,用以將攝取的圖像數字信號輸 出至所述現場可編程門陣列FPGA模塊進行圖像處理;一主控器,分別設有一 CAMERA接口模 塊連接所述現場可編程門陣列FPGA模塊用以接收圖像數字信號,一 LCD接口模塊連接所述 第一圖像顯示接口模塊用以傳遞圖像數字信號;一顯示設備,連接所述第二圖像顯示接口 模塊;當所述現場可編程門陣列FPGA模塊的圖像輸出分辨率與所述顯示設備的分辨率不 匹配時,由主控器傳遞圖像數字信號至所述第一圖像顯示接口模塊借由所述現場可編程門 陣列FPGA模塊調整,再由所述第二圖像顯示接口模塊輸送至所述顯示設備用以實現相匹 配的分辨率。
[0009] 進一步,所述第一圖像顯示接口模塊為IXD接口模塊。
[0010] 進一步,所述顯示設備為投影儀。
[0011] 進一步,所述顯示設備為顯示器。
[0012] 進一步,包括一數模轉換芯片,所述數模轉換芯片連接所述第二圖像顯示接口模 塊用以將數字信號轉換成模擬信號。
[0013] 進一步,所述顯示器連接所述數模轉換芯片。
[0014] 進一步,包括至少一同步動態隨機存儲器SDRAM模組連接所述現場可編程門陣列 FPGA模塊,所述同步動態隨機存儲器SDRAM模組用以接收和存儲所述圖像傳感器傳送的圖 像數字信號。
[0015] 進一步,所述主控器設有一 GPMC接口模塊連接所述現場可編程門陣列FPGA模塊 用以傳輸數據及通信。
[0016] 進一步,所述主控器設有一網口與外部設備連接用以實現數據通信。
[0017] 進一步,所述主控器選用德州儀器的處理器DM3730。
[0018] 與現有技術相比,本實用新型當所述現場可編程門陣列FPGA模塊的圖像輸出分 辨率與所述顯示設備分辨率不匹配時,由主控器傳遞圖像數字信號至所述第一圖像顯示 接口模塊借由所述現場可編程門陣列FPGA模塊調整至與顯示設備相匹配的圖像輸出分辨 率,再由所述第二圖像顯示接口模塊輸送至所述顯示設備,因此可以根據不同顯示設備的 分辨率需求進行圖像輸出分辨率的調整,實現與不同分辨率的顯示設備進行通信連接,利 于用戶對顯示設備選擇的靈活性需求且可以充分利用現有的顯示設備資源。 【【附圖說明】】
[0019] 圖1為本實用新型工業相機系統第一實施例的結構圖;
[0020] 圖2為本實用新型工業相機系統第二實施例的結構圖;
[0021] 圖3為本實用新型工業相機系統與外部設備連接使用的示意圖。
[0022] 【具體實施方式】的附圖標號說明:
【【具體實施方式】】
[0024] 為便于更好的理解本實用新型的目的、結構、特征以及功效等,現結合附圖和具體 實施方式對本實用新型作進一步說明。
[0025] 請參閱圖1和圖3,本實用新型工業相機系統的第一實施例,所述工業相機系統包 括一工業相機A以及一顯示設備4,所述工業相機A具有一現場可編程門陣列FPGA模塊1, 以及分別與所述現場可編程門陣列FPGA模塊1連接的圖像傳感器2、主控器3、至少一同步 動態隨機存儲器SDRAM模組5。
[0026] 所述現場可編程門陣列FPGA模塊1分別設有一第一圖像顯示接口模塊11、一第二 圖像顯示接口模塊12,所述第一圖像顯示接口模塊11與第二圖像顯示接口模塊12都選用 LCD接口模塊。
[0027] 所述圖像傳感器2 -般的分辨為1366x768,所述圖像傳感器2連接所述現場可編 程門陣列FPGA模塊1,用以將采集到的圖像數字信號傳送至所述現場可編程門陣列FPGA模 塊1進行圖像處理。
[0028] 所述主控器3選用美國德州儀器公司的DM3730數字處理器,它包含了 1個IGHz的 ARM Cortex-A8處理器滿足操作系統的運行,1個主頻800MHz的TMS320C64x+DSP處理器能 夠為高密集計算的算法提供處理,所述主控器分別設有一 CAMERA接口模塊31、一 IXD接口 模塊32、一 GPMC接口模塊33以及與外部設備7連接的一網口 34,所述外部設備7如計算 機,所述CAMERA接口模塊31連接所述現場可編程門陣列FPGA模塊1用以接收現場可編程 門陣列FPGA模塊1輸出的圖像數字信號,所述LCD接口模塊32連接所述第一圖像顯示接 口模塊11用以傳遞所述現場可編程門陣列FPGA模塊1輸出的圖像數字信號,所述GPMC接 口模塊33連接所述現場可編程門陣列FPGA模塊1用以與所述現場可編程門陣列FPGA模 塊1之間的數據傳輸。
[0029] 所述顯示設備4 一般分辨率為1280x800的投影儀41,所述投影儀41連接所述第 二圖像顯示接口模塊12。
[0030]圖像傳感器2采集圖像,通過內置模數轉換芯片將模擬信號轉化為圖像數字信 號,然后將圖像數字信號再輸送至所述現場可編程門陣